Default KQs, how\'s my line?

Party Poker (6 max, 6 handed) converter

NL $25

Hero has 24.65, SB has him covered
Preflop: Hero is MP with K[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img], Q[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img].
UTG limps, UTG+1 folds, Hero raises to 1.50, CO folds,Button calls, SB calls, BB folds, UTG folds

Flop: Q[img]/images/graemlins/heart.gif[/img], 5[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img], 4[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img] <font color="#0000FF">(3 players)</font>
SB checks, Hero bets 3, Button Folds, SB calls

Turn: T[img]/images/graemlins/club.gif[/img] <font color="#0000FF">(2 players)</font>
SB checks. Hero Bets $5, SB Calls

River: K[img]/images/graemlins/heart.gif[/img] <font color="#0000FF">(2 players)</font>

SB checks, Hero goes all in for 15.15, SB calls

Final Pot:

How's the line? Comments on all streets appriciated

Preflop: is fine. Although you have to assign SB a hand range from mid pockets up and suited broadways.
Flop: I actually really like this bet. Your hand is strong now and can be stronger later, so there is no reason to push others out.
Turn: Since SB flat called the flop &amp; called preflop, I would have to assume that he either has A[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img]Q, KQ, A[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img]J[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img], or a set. I think here I'd have to check behind and be re-evaluate on the river.
River: Why? What does he call with here that you beat? Since he flat called the turn, I think AQ becomes very unlikely.

Here's the thing on the turn: the only hands that he is gonna fold here are the hands that you WANT him to call with. Because of the preflop and flop action, you can rule out SB having many of the hands that might pay you off here (weaker Queens, Jacks). You won't make AQ fold, you won't make a set fold. About the only hand that will call here that you are ahead of is the highly unlikely (due to preflop action) QTs. The rest of the time, I feel this bet is a waste.

Again, though, I am continuing to refine my thought process on bets in these situations and am open to more discussion.
